Understanding Dreams of Hopelessness in Celebration
Dreams filled with celebration are often associated with joy, community, and happiness. However, when these dreams are tinged with hopelessness, they can leave one feeling bewildered and distressed. The juxtaposition of celebration and despair in one’s dreams invites us to reflect on our inner emotional landscape.
It suggests that while we may outwardly participate in joyful occasions, there may be underlying feelings of sadness, isolation, or unfulfilled desires. The significance of such dreams cannot be overstated, as they often serve as a mirror to our conscience, revealing struggles that may be overlooked in our waking lives. It is essential to listen to these dreams, for they carry messages from our deeper self, urging us to confront our emotions and seek balance between celebration and the reality of our current state.
Recognizing these inner conflicts is the first step towards spiritual and emotional healing.

Practical Insights for Understanding Celebration Dreams
- Reflect on Your Recent Celebrations
Take some time to consider your recent experiences related to celebration. Were there particular events where you felt detached or uncomfortable? Reflecting on these occasions can unveil hidden emotions that may be affecting your dreams.
Create a journal where you can write down your feelings about these events and how they made you feel. This practice of self-reflection may help to bridge the gap between your internal struggles and your interactions with others.
- Engage in Open Conversations
Sometimes, sharing your dream experiences with trustworthy friends or family can provide insights that you might not see alone. Engaging in conversations about how you feel during celebrations can also help to release any pent-up feelings of hopelessness or sadness. Family gatherings or social events may have left you feeling apart, and expressing these feelings can create a supportive environment for healing.
Cultivating a community where you can freely discuss these dream experiences may lead to a nuanced understanding of your emotional self.
- Seek Spiritual Guidance
Consider seeking comfort from spiritual texts or mentors who can help you explore the deeper meanings of your dreams. Reflecting on a verse or teaching that speaks to despair and hope can offer reassurance and clarity during difficult times. Engage in prayer or meditation to connect with your spiritual side, allowing you to feel guided towards inner peace.
This practice not only aids in understanding your dreams but can also lead to profound personal growth and healing.
- Practice Mindfulness
Incorporate mindfulness into your daily routine to help ground yourself in the present moment.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ation or deep-breathing exercises, can aid in reducing feelings of anxiety and hopelessness. By being present, you cultivate an awareness that can enhance your emotional intelligence, making it easier to understand the relationship between your feelings and your dreams.
This greater awareness may help you navigate through your feelings during celebrations and find joy amidst any lingering despair.
- Embrace Creative Expression
Channel your emotions through creative outlets such as writing, painting, or music. Engaging in these activities can provide a therapeutic space to explore feelings of hopelessness or isolation experienced during dreams of celebration. The act of creating allows you to process complex emotions and can even lead to insight about why these feelings arise during such joyous occasions.
By letting your creativity flow, you give voice to what may be trapped inside, leading to greater self-discovery and transformation.
FAQs
- What does it mean to dream about feeling hopeless during a celebration?
Dreaming of feeling hopeless during a celebration often symbolizes unresolved feelings or conflicts within your life. While celebrations generally bring happiness, your dreams may reflect underlying sadness or anxiety that you are not consciously addressing. This dissonance can serve as a reminder of the need to confront and process your emotions, allowing you to seek a sense of balance in life.
- Can these dreams indicate something specific about my current situation?
Yes, dreams of hopelessness during celebrations can indicate a disconnect between your external life and internal feelings. They may signal that you are experiencing stress, disappointment, or feelings of inadequacy that you are not fully acknowledging. It is essential to thoughtfully consider the relationships and situations in your waking life that might be influencing these dreams.
- How can I find meaning in these dreams?
Finding meaning in dreams of hopelessness during celebration involves self-reflection and exploration of your feelings. Journaling your dreams upon waking, discussing them with someone you trust, or seeking guidance from spiritual texts can help uncover the emotions behind these dreams. Understanding the context of your life and how it correlates with the dream can lead to significant insights about your emotional state.
- Are these dreams common?
It is not uncommon for individuals to experience dreams of contradiction, where feelings of hopelessness emerge during typically joyful settings. Many people find that their dreams often reveal a deeper emotional reality that may not align with their waking self. Acknowledging these dreams as part of your overall emotional journey is a constructive way to process complex feelings that arise.
- What steps can I take if I frequently dream of hopelessness in celebration?
If these dreams are frequent, it is essential to take proactive steps towards understanding your feelings and addressing any underlying emotional issues. Engaging in therapeutic practices like mindfulness, seeking spiritual guidance, and creating an open dialogue about your emotions can provide relief. It may also be beneficial to consult a professional, such as a therapist who is skilled in dream analysis, to explore these feelings further.
